Recent Form + Tactical Duel

Spalding United’s last 5: 0-0 Bromsgrove (D), 1-1 St Ives (D), 3-2 Halesowen (W), 0-2 Needham (L), 3-0 Redditch (W)—strong home control with 91 goals scored league-wide, possession-dominant style (avg shots high). According to Sofascore data on Spalding’s profile, their form shines. Stourbridge’s form is patchier (3 wins in last 5 per trends, recent 0-3 loss), favoring counters but weak away (16th place). Expect Spalding to boss possession via Nicholson/Sembie-Ferris on left-wing breakthroughs, forcing Stourbridge into long balls—leading to a controlled home advantage. Injuries, Head-to-Head and Background Motivation

No fresh injuries for Spalding (Moore back from past issues), but Stourbridge has quiet news—full squad likely but form motivation low at 16th vs Spalding’s title push (2nd, +47 GD). H2H favors Spalding 3-0-0 recently (low-scoring affairs), home pressure at Sir Halley Stewart Field amplifies their lineup’s tactical targeting.
